What is log base 2 of 229?
The log base 2 of 229 is 7.8392037881, because 2 raised to the power of 7.8392037881 equals 229.

How to calculate log base 2 of 229
1
First, identify the target value x = 229.
2
Apply the change-of-base formula:
log₂(x) = ln(x) / ln(2).3
Calculate the natural logarithms:
ln(229) ≈ 5.433722
ln(2) ≈ 0.693147

4
Divide the values to get the final result: 7.8392037881.
